





Chitrealekha' lehenga and βPrabhaβ blouse in Varanasi silk brocade feature weave that is drawn from our textile archives, made using the elaborate Kadwa technique, where each motif is woven separately in a 'jangla' pattern. It has a play of Meenakari on the trellis of flowers, inspired by printed textiles such as kalamkari chintz depicting flora and fauna. Shivani pairs it with sheer organza βUnnaoβ odhani with all-over hand-embroidered Mughal leaf βjaalβ and kiran along the border.
